A manager, quality engineer ensures that a company's products and processes meet established quality standards by identifying shortfalls, developing corrective measures, and implementing quality control systems. They work with managers and supervisors to implement quality measures.
Some of the functions that they perform include developing and implementing quality standards, developing and implementing quality control systems, monitoring and analyzing quality performance, collaborating with operations managers to develop and implement improvements. In addition, they are also responsible for ensuring that workflows, processes, and products comply with safety guidelines and review codes and specifications. Other qualifications include a bachelor's degree in industrial or mechanical engineering or a related field; although, a master's degree may be given preference. Moreover, ASQ certification will be given preference. Essential skills include communication, interpersonal, analytical, and problem solving.
The average hourly salary for the position is $60.67, which equates to $126,202 annually. The career is expected to grow in the coming years and create new opportunities all across the United States.

The average manager, quality engineer salary in the United States is $121,191 per year or $58 per hour. Manager, quality engineer salaries range between $90,000 and $163,000 per year.
